业务服务器和数据库放在一起?

服务器

业务服务器与数据库的整合:是合并还是分离?

结论:在现代信息技术环境中,业务服务器与数据库的配置是一个需要深思熟虑的问题。虽然将两者放在一起可以简化部署和管理,但这种做法并非总是最优解。实际上,根据业务规模、数据安全需求、系统性能和运维复杂性等因素,分开部署往往能带来更高效、安全和稳定的服务。

分析探讨:

在小型或初创企业中,将业务服务器和数据库放在同一台设备上可能是经济高效的解决方案,因为这样可以减少硬件投资和初期的运维成本。然而,由于业务的发展和数据量的增长,这种一体化的模式可能会暴露出一些问题。

首先,性能问题。数据库操作通常需要大量的计算资源,特别是当处理大量并发请求时。如果业务服务器和数据库共享资源,可能会影响业务应用的响应速度,甚至导致服务中断。反之,如果独立部署,数据库服务器可以专门优化以满足高并发、大数据量的处理需求。

其次,安全性考虑。数据库通常包含企业的核心数据,其安全性至关重要。一旦遭受攻击,损失可能无法估量。将数据库与业务服务器分开,可以降低因业务层面的安全漏洞影响到数据的风险。此外,对数据库服务器的访问控制和安全策略可以更加严格,进一步保障数据安全。

再者,运维复杂性。分开部署意味着更复杂的运维,但同时也带来了更高的灵活性和可扩展性。例如,当需要升级或维护数据库时,不会影响业务服务器的正常运行,反之亦然。同时,可以根据业务需求和负载变化,独立地调整和优化服务器和数据库的资源配置。

最后,合规性要求。在某些行业,如X_X、X_X等,法规可能要求数据存储和处理必须遵循特定的安全标准,这可能需要数据库与业务服务器的物理隔离。

综上所述,业务服务器和数据库是否应放在一起,并无定论。这完全取决于企业的具体需求、发展阶段、资源限制以及对安全和性能的考量。在决策时,应全面评估各种因素,选择最符合当前和未来业务需求的架构方案。无论是整合还是分离,关键在于确保系统的稳定、安全和高效,以支持企业的发展和创新。

未经允许不得转载:CDNK博客 » 业务服务器和数据库放在一起?